Choosing the right roof insulation technique for the job (certified roofer)

Interior insulation

Recommended when the roof covering is sound and you want to limit cost and job time. In practice, the main limitation comes from thermal bridges at the rafters and tricky junctions, and the risk of condensation if the vapour barrier is discontinuous or pierced (downlights, hatches, ducts).

Exterior insulation (sarking)

Ideal during a roof covering renovation, since it preserves living volume and better addresses thermal bridges. Points to watch: eave build-up, airtightness, continuity at the ridge, and connections around roof windows.

Unconverted loft

Blown-in insulation aims for an even distribution. Protect downlights, keep the ventilation clear, install depth gauges, and avoid compacting the insulation. The spreading follows installation rules for lasting performance.

Flat roof

Principle: insulation + waterproofing in continuity. Common mistakes: poorly treated upstands, unaddressed penetrations, insulation interrupted at parapets. A good certified roofer for insulation secures these details.

Thermal performance: targeting the right resistance (R) without unnecessary extra thickness

Understanding R, lambda, and thickness

R resistance measures a surface's ability to slow the passage of heat. It depends directly on lambda (λ), which indicates the material's conductivity, and on thickness. In short, the lower λ is, the better R you get with less thickness. Hence the value of thinking in terms of a "target R" suited to the roof, rather than centimetres "by feel," especially when the available height is limited.

Thermal bridges in the roof

At the rafters, the sensitive zones are the rafters themselves, wall-roof junctions, loft hatches, the base of the slope, and around roof windows. The most robust solution is to create a continuous layer, or to cross insulation layers to cover the frame, with careful connections at tricky junctions.

Airtightness and vapour barrier

Without airtightness, the insulation gets bypassed by leaks that cool the surface and encourage condensation. A well-connected vapour barrier (or equivalent), with no untreated perforations, limits moisture transfer and prevents mould and other problems. A good certified roofer for insulation secures these details, often invisible but decisive.

Roof insulation materials: what the roofer should compare before costing

Uses, constraints, and points to watch

Between mineral wool, wood fibre, and cellulose wadding, the choice mainly depends on the job. Mineral wool remains practical for rafters, as rolls or panels, with fast installation and a predictable cost. Cellulose wadding lends itself very well to blowing into unconverted lofts, useful for filling gaps, but it requires proper density and good management of hatches and upstands. Wood fibre brings good summer comfort, but it is heavier and more sensitive to storage and moisture.

  • Fire and smoke. Check the product's fire reaction class, especially on the interior side.
  • Moisture. The combination of a breather membrane, ventilation, and a vapour barrier or vapour control layer prevents condensation and settling.
  • Long-term durability. Check the technical approvals, certifications, and resistance to settling for loose-fill products.
  • Compatibility with the roof covering. Tiles and slate tolerate a ventilated sub-roof well. With steel decking, the condensation risk rises. The accessories matter: breather membrane, sealing tapes, hangers, facings. A good certified roofer for insulation prices more accurately when these details are planned from the start.

Profitability for the roofer: costing, installation time, and margin on roof insulation

Breaking down a price

A readable quote starts by separating supplies (insulation, vapour barrier, tapes), labor, protective measures (scaffolding, tarps, dust management), then finishing (counter-battens, boards, airtightness patch-ups). For a certified roofer doing insulation, this breakdown justifies the price per m² and avoids "gut feeling" discussions.

Job time

  • You gain hours when access is straightforward, spacing is regular, and installation is continuous.
  • You lose them with heavily cut-up rafters, hatches, downlights, valleys, and fixing thermal bridges.

Selling at the right price

Explain the gap with a "cheap" offer by talking about durability: vapour barrier continuity, treatment of tricky junctions, checks, and guarantees. Durable insulation protects the client from rework and secures you a healthy margin. 2026 funding: securing your files without getting stuck (certified roofer, insulation)

Applications: frequent check points

In 2026, blockages mainly come from non-compliant quotes, inconsistent dates, and certification not valid at the time of commitment. Check that the quote is signed before work starts, that the job-site address matches the funded dwelling, and that your insulation characteristics are documented (area, U-value achieved, thickness). For a whole-house retrofit, plan ahead for the review with the retrofit coordinator, otherwise the file stalls.

Supporting documents, compliance, pitfalls

Prepare the complete client declaration, the detailed invoice, proof that the request predates the work, and photos if required. The classic pitfall is a missing mention or a work package flagged "unsatisfactory" during an audit, which can block the payout.

Certification: staying squared away

  • Consistent quote and invoice. Same wording, same quantities, same performance figures.
  • Precise certification mentions, declared subcontracting, company registration number, and scope of work.

Avoiding claims: the quality checks that protect your liability

Ventilation and moisture

Before closing up a ceiling or rafter space, check the vapour barrier's continuity, the treatment of junctions, and air circulation. High-performance insulation without properly regulated ventilation is a condensation risk, and therefore a mould risk. During the work, keep air inlets and extraction grilles clear, then test suction at the end of installation (a simple tissue test) and do a round of the damp rooms.

Waterproofing details on the roof

Edges, ridge, flashing, MVHR outlets, flues, and lead work are the zones where water looks for a way in. For a certified roofer doing insulation, the rule is clear: consistent layout, suitable fixings, overlaps, and protection around penetrations.

Self-inspection at the end of the job

  • 10 minutes as a team. Photos before, during, after.
  • Check airflow rates, grilles, air inlets, and the absence of musty smells.
  • Check alignments, joints, tricky junctions, and cleanliness of drains.
